In this episode, Mark is talking with Anna Wolfe about Mississippi's Welfare Scandal.

Anna Wolfe is an investigative reporter for Mississippi Today, a nonprofit newsroom founded in 2016. Her coverage of poverty, public assistance and debtors prisons has received national recognition, including the Goldsmith Prize, the Collier Prize and the National Press Foundation’s Poverty and Inequality Award. 

Before joining the staff at Mississippi Today, she held several beats at Mississippi’s statewide newspaper, the Clarion Ledger, where she covered city hall and reported award-winning stories about medical billing and hunger in the Mississippi Delta. Born and raised in Washington State, Wolfe attended Mississippi State University and has lived in Jackson, Mississippi since graduating in 2014.

Tune in to hear an in-depth discussion about the welfare scandal, how it started, who’s involved, and how this has affected the residents of Mississippi.
